The landscape of Fantasy Football is constantly evolving, and while elite NFL Quarterbacks often dominate early draft rounds, securing a high-upside signal-caller in the later stages can be a game-winning strategy. This season, savvy managers are turning their attention to Late-Round QBs who possess the potential to significantly outperform their average draft position, providing crucial value without a hefty investment.

Among the most intriguing prospects for the upcoming 2025 season is Cam Ward, a dynamic passer who has already demonstrated flashes of brilliance. Drafted as the number one overall pick, Ward brings a powerful arm, impressive rushing ability, and a knack for extending plays outside the pocket. His transition to the professional ranks is keenly watched by Fantasy Football enthusiasts, eager to see how his unique skill set translates.

Ward’s situation with the Tennessee Titans appears ripe for a breakout, especially with a formidable receiving corps led by Calvin Ridley, alongside talents like Tyler Lockett, Van Jefferson, and Chig Okonkwo. The Titans are anticipated to adopt a pass-heavy offensive scheme, a strategic shift that could considerably boost Cam Ward Fantasy production. Expect an aggressive downfield approach from Ward, which, while carrying some risk, could also lead to explosive, high-scoring Fantasy Football outings.

Another compelling Late-Round QB option is Michael Penix Jr., who seized the starting role in the latter half of the 2024 season and immediately elevated his team’s performance. Under his leadership, the offense averaged an impressive 32 points per game, showcasing a much more dynamic and efficient attack. His ability to quickly adapt and lead a high-scoring unit makes him a prime target for those looking for upside.

Penix Jr. in Atlanta benefits from a talented group of pass-catchers, including the formidable Drake London, Darnell Mooney, Ray-Ray McCloud III, and tight end Kyle Pitts. While Bijan Robinson is expected to command a significant workload in the backfield, the Falcons will still rely heavily on Penix Jr. to distribute the ball effectively and find the endzone. This blend of pass-catching talent and a balanced offensive approach fuels optimism for Michael Penix Jr. Fantasy value.

Veteran quarterback Matthew Stafford also warrants attention as a potential under-the-radar pick this season. Despite dealing with a back injury during the offseason, Stafford has recently returned to the field, signaling his readiness to contribute. His proven track record and experience make him a reliable choice for managers seeking consistency from their NFL Quarterbacks.

The Los Angeles Rams offense, under Stafford’s guidance, is bolstered by an elite receiving duo featuring newly acquired Davante Adams and the burgeoning star Puka Nacua. This potent combination creates one of the league’s most dangerous pass-catching groups. If Matthew Stafford Fantasy managers can count on him to stay healthy throughout the season, he is poised to deliver another solid year of production, making him a strategic acquisition for any Fantasy Football roster looking for a veteran presence.
